Louth residents face crumbling infrastructure in estates built decades ago, with potholes costing thousands. Councillors push for a clear plan to fix these unfinished developments, with one estate waiting nearly ten years for repairs. The council works through active sites and reviews priority spots, aiming to end the wait for communities and provide solid roads and certainty.
